帮你译了:
解决问题的步骤
计算机能够解决问题吗?当然不行。它只不过是一个能够处理程序员指令的机器,实际解决问题的是程序员。以下是解决问题遵循的几个步骤:
第一步:程序员需要清楚的理解这个问题。这意味着他/她需要大致的决定如何解决这个问题。有些问题很简单,然而有的则要花几个月去研究。在开始之前,程序员永远都应该自问“我是否理解了这个问题”。
第二步:程序员需要制定算法(algorithm),这是解决问题的程序中紧接着的一步。制定算法是最重要的部分,它通常也是非常耗时的。“算法”通常被描述为“流程图”(由一系列严格的语句所描述)或“框图”,后者是一种用图表来描述解决问题中会出现的事件的顺序的方法,事件之间用箭头来表示。
→框图能够体现某个步骤是否需要重复操作或者是否有需要二选一的过程。
第三步:程序员需要将算法或流程图转换成电脑程序。在做这一步时,他/她需要运用许多适合的计算机语言中的一种,严格按照流程图算法的顺序来给计算机编写详细的指令。计算机程序通常是用有特定格式规定的编码编写的。
第四步:接下来程序员需要录入电脑程序,或者把程序编码交给录入员处理。电脑程序将被记录到打孔卡上,更经常地是利用带有可视显示单元的终端来录入的电脑的。
第五步:然后电脑程序需要经过测试。在进行这个工作时,电脑操作员将一叠打孔卡放到读卡机内,然后按下“读出”按钮。这一步将信息传送到电脑的存储器里。接下来,打印输出材料会显示程序是否正常工作或者打孔卡是否输入了指令。如果可能的话,通过一些命令的帮助,可以将程序初春在电脑的存储器里并得到打印输出材料。
第六步:最后一步是往程序里补充数据,最终彻底地开始工作。接下来电脑会开始进行必要的演算以解决问题。它会遵循程序里最微小的细节来运作。因此,我们可以把电脑称作机器人,它不会思考,仅仅会按照别人所说的去做事。
(给楼下的:尊重他人劳动成果,请勿抄袭答案!)
10分太少咯
步入解决问题,计算机能中解决问题? 确定地不是。 这是执行规程这个程序员给它的机器。这是这个程序员然后谁解决 问题。有一个有跟随在解决问题的几步: 步骤1 。这个程序员必须 清楚地定义这个问题。这意味着他或她必须确定, 用一个一般方式 , 怎么解决这个问题。有些问题是容易的, 虽然其他人需要几个月 研究。这个程序员应该总开始由要求: 我能了解问题吗?.. 步 骤2 。这个程序员必须公式化算法, 是步一个平直向前序列指示使 用解决这个问题。修建算法是最重要的部分的解决问题和通常费时 。算法可能由图样, 也许陈述根据精确句子序列, 或结构图描 述。后者是事件顺序的一个图表表示法随后而来在解决这个问题。 关系在事件之间被显示通过3。结构图可能显示如果过程必 须被重覆或这那里是供选择的路线被采取。步骤3 。这个程序员必 须翻译这个算法或图样成计算机程序。做如此, 他或她写详 细的指示为计算机, 使用许多人计算机语言的当中一个可得到跟随 图样 算法的确切的序列。这个节目通常被写在有一个具体格 式画在他们的编制程序板料。步骤4。这个程序员必须然后打孔这个 节目, 或给编制程序板料这个键盘操作员做它。这个节目也, 比较 通常, 被猛击在卡片或被进入计算机于一个终端与一个显示器单位 。步骤5 。这个节目必须然后被测试。做如此, 计算机操作员投入 卡片组在卡片输入机和按读按钮。这转移信息计算机的记忆 。供选择, 这个节目必须读从盘入记忆。其次, 打印输出显示如果 这个节目运作或如果它有卡片进入指示它是可能的, 在的帮助下几 个命令, 存放这个节目在计算机的记忆和得到打印输出。步骤6 。 最后步将增加数据来这个节目和完全地运行这个工作。计算机然后 将执行演算必要解决这个问题。它将跟随执行演算必要解决这个问 题。它将遵守指示在这个节目微小细节。所以, 你可能认为计 算机是机器人。它不思考, 但简单地做它被告诉事。
对答复者说:不是十分太少,首先你得掂量你的答案。